{"apiVersion":"1.0","identifier":"CVE-2026-80719","description":"In the Linux kernel, the following vulnerability has been resolved: mm: mglru: fix stale batch updates after memcg reparenting The mglru page table walker batches per-generation size deltas in walk->nr_pages while walking page tables without holding the lruvec lock. The reset_batch_size() later folds those deltas into walk->lruvec under the lruvec lock. The page table walker can run concurrently with the memcg reparenting path as follows: CPU0 CPU1 ==== ==== walk_mm --> walk_page_range --> update_batch_size --> walk->nr_pages += delta mem_cgroup_css_offline --> memcg_reparent_objcgs --> lock lruvec lru_gen_reparent_memcg --> reparent child folios to parent unlock lruvec lock lruvec reset_batch_size --> child lrugen->nr_pages += delta This will trigger the following warning in lru_gen_exit_memcg(): VM_WARN_ON_ONCE(memchr_inv(lruvec->lrugen.nr_pages, 0, sizeof(lruvec->lrugen.nr_pages))); And the user-visible impact of underestimated nr_pages in MGLRU was premature OOMs because MGLRU does not try to reclaim memory when nr_pages reaches zero, but there are still more pages. To fix it, make reset_batch_size() check CSS_DYING under RCU before flushing the pending batch. A non-dying memcg keeps the original lruvec stable against RCU-delayed offlining; a dying memcg redirects the deltas to the first non-dying ancestor.","publishedAt":"2026-08-28T08:16:57","lastModifiedAt":"2026-08-28T08:16:57","sourceUrl":"https://nvd.nist.gov/vuln/detail/CVE-2026-80719","cvssScore":null,"cvssVector":"Pending","epssProbability":0.00145,"riskScore":0,"affectedProduct":"Linux kernel","affectedVersions":"unknown","vulnerabilityType":"Kernel","operatingSystems":[],"links":{"self":"https://www.redsauce.net/api/cves/CVE-2026-80719","webPages":{"es":"https://www.redsauce.net/es/cves/CVE-2026-80719","en":"https://www.redsauce.net/en/cves/CVE-2026-80719","fr":"https://www.redsauce.net/fr/cves/CVE-2026-80719","pt":"https://www.redsauce.net/pt/cves/CVE-2026-80719","de":"https://www.redsauce.net/de/cves/CVE-2026-80719","sk":"https://www.redsauce.net/sk/cves/CVE-2026-80719","el":"https://www.redsauce.net/el/cves/CVE-2026-80719"},"source":"https://nvd.nist.gov/vuln/detail/CVE-2026-80719"}}
